Kuba> IIRC if you don't get too fancy the Qt file browser simply Kuba> launches a standard windows dialog box which IIRC handles Kuba> shortcuts fine? As long as it returns the resolved path, not the Kuba> one of the shortcut, of course. Currently in 1.3.x we (almost) always use the Qt file browser. In 1.4.0cvs the native browser is used for Qt/Mac, and it would not be difficult to do the same for Qt/Win. The drawback is that one loses the directory buttons that we add. So, that's a trade-off.
